Takeda Pharma files patent infringement suit against Dr Reddys

PTI | 09:04 PM,Apr 12,2011

Hyderabad, Apr 12 (PTI) Global pharma major Takeda Pharmaceutical Co has filed a patent infringement suit against India�s second largest drug maker Dr Reddy�s Laboratories in a New York Court over the latter�s efforts to manufacture a generic version of acid reflux treatment drug Dexilant (Dexlansoprazole). Takeda alleged that the Indian generic-drug maker and its US subsidiary Dr Reddy�s Laboratories Inc have infringed US Patent Numbers through the submission of an abbreviated new drug application seeking approval to market generic versions of Dexilent, a patented drug of Takeda. Dexilant is used to treat g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D), a condition in which stomach acid backflows (refluxes) into the esophagus, causing heartburn and possible injury to the esophagus. According to Takeda, the two patents which it alleged Dr Reddy�s infringed would expire in June 2020 and August 2026. Takeda which got the approval from the US FAD to market Dexlansoprazole, changed its name to Dexilent from the earlier Kapidex in March 2010. Takeda further said it got a mandatory notice from Dr Reddy�s on February 21 about their Dexlansoprazole ANDA filing which contained a Paragraph IV certification, a legal assertion that the patents covering Dexilant are invalid. Takeda requested the court to refrain it from manufacturing, sale and distribution and import of the drug. According to reports, US sales of Dexilant delayed-release capsules, 30 mg and 60 mg were about USD20 million and USD261 million, respectively, for the 12 months ending January 2011. When contacted, an official spokesperson of Dr Reddy�s offered no comments.
